American Sports Story: Aaron Hernandez Recap: Happy Enough
Briefly

Aaron's sudden rise to fame has made him realize that so many young players before him discovered: fame can restrict one's freedom and destroy personal growth.
The show explores whether Aaron, facing imminent fatherhood, can transition into a family man despite his youth and the emotional chaos around him.
Aaron struggles with his true feelings for Chris while balancing the responsibilities of impending fatherhood and a relationship he's not ready to define.
Tanya's conversation with Aaron reveals his inability to maintain his usual lifestyle, stressing that he must come to terms with his complexities soon.
